What is 34/28 Divided By 4/9

Answer: 3428÷49\frac{34}{28}\div\frac{4}{9} = 15356\frac{153}{56}

Solving 3428÷49\frac{34}{28}\div\frac{4}{9}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

3428÷49=3428×94\frac{34}{28} \div \frac{4}{9} = \frac{34}{28} \times \frac{9}{4}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 34×9=30634 \times 9 = 306
  • Multiply the Denominators: 28×4=11228 \times 4 = 112
  • Form the New Fraction: 3428×49=306112\frac{34}{28} \times \frac{4}{9} = \frac{306}{112}

Let's Simplify 306112\frac{306}{112}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 306306 and 112112. The GCD of 306306 and 112112 is 22.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:306÷2112÷2=15356\frac{306 \div 2}{112 \div 2} = \frac{153}{56}

Answer 3428÷49=15356\frac{34}{28}\div\frac{4}{9} = \frac{153}{56}
